php中怎么添加图片
-
在PHP中添加图片非常简单,你可以使用HTML中的
标签或PHP的内置函数来实现。下面是两种常用的方法:
1. 使用HTML的
标签:
在需要插入图片的位置,使用以下代码:
“`html
“`
其中,src属性指定了图片的URL地址,alt属性是图片的描述,可以为空。2. 使用PHP的内置函数:
可以使用imagecreatefromjpeg()/imagecreatefrompng()等函数来创建一张图片,然后使用imagejpeg()/imagepng()等函数将图片保存到指定位置。以下是一个示例:
“`php
$width = 300;
$height = 300;// 创建一张新的画布
$image = imagecreatetruecolor($width, $height);// 填充背景颜色
$background_color = imagecolorallocate($image, 255, 255, 255);
imagefill($image, 0, 0, $background_color);// 添加图片
$picture = imagecreatefromjpeg(“图片的路径”);
imagecopy($image, $picture, 0, 0, 0, 0, $width, $height);// 保存图片到指定位置
imagejpeg($image, “保存图片的路径”);// 释放内存
imagedestroy($image);
imagedestroy($picture);
“`
其中,$width和$height分别代表图片的宽度和高度,imagecreatetruecolor()函数用于创建一张新的画布,imagecolorallocate()函数用于设置背景颜色,imagefill()函数用于填充背景颜色,imagecreatefromjpeg()函数用于读取图片文件,imagecopy()函数用于将图片复制到画布上,imagejpeg()函数用于保存图片到指定位置,imagedestroy()函数用于释放内存。无论使用何种方法,都需要确保图片的URL或路径是正确的,否则图片无法显示。另外,为了避免加载过慢,可以使用合适大小的图片,并且使用图片格式压缩图片文件。
2年前 -
在PHP中,要添加图片可以使用以下方法:
1. 使用HTML标签:PHP与HTML标签可以结合使用,因此可以直接在PHP代码中使用
标签来添加图片。例如:
“`php
“;
?>
“`2. 使用PHP的内置函数处理图片:PHP提供了一系列内置函数来处理图片,如imagecreatefromjpeg()、imagecreatefrompng()等,可以用来创建图片资源,并进行各种操作,如缩放、裁剪、添加水印等。例如:
“`php
“`3. 使用第三方库:除了PHP的内置函数外,还可以使用第三方库来处理图片,如GD库、Imagick等。这些库具有更丰富的功能,可以实现更复杂的图片处理操作。例如使用GD库来添加文字水印:
“`php
“`4. 使用CSS样式:除了使用
标签,还可以使用CSS的background属性来添加图片。可以在PHP代码中为HTML元素添加样式,然后在CSS中设置背景图片。例如:
“`php
“;
?>
“`5. 使用外部链接:如果图片不在本地服务器上,也可以使用外部链接来添加图片。只需要将图片的URL地址作为src属性的值即可。例如:
“`php
“;
?>
“`以上是一些常用的在PHP中添加图片的方法,可以根据实际情况选择适合的方式来实现需求。
2年前
在PHP中添加图片可以使用HTML的标签或者使用CSS的background-image属性。
方法一:使用HTML的标签
1. 在HTML文件中,使用标签来添加图片,如下所示:
2. 图片路径可以是相对路径或者绝对路径,如果图片与HTML文件在同一个目录下,可以使用相对路径,如:

3. alt属性是图片的替代文本,当图片无法显示时,会显示替代文本。
方法二:使用CSS的background-image属性
1. 在HTML文件中,使用
2. 在CSS文件中,使用background-image属性来添加背景图片,如下所示:
.example {
background-image: url(“图片路径”);
}
3. 图片路径可以是相对路径或者绝对路径,如果图片与CSS文件在同一个目录下,可以使用相对路径,如:
.example {
background-image: url(“../images/example.jpg”);
}
注意事项:
1. 确保图片路径正确,且图片存在。
2. 如果使用相对路径,应注意当前文件所在的目录位置。
3. 可以使用CSS的background-size属性来调整图片的尺寸。
操作流程:
1. 准备好要添加的图片文件。
2. 在HTML文件中,选择合适的位置添加标签或者元素并设置class属性。
3. 在CSS文件中,选择对应的class,并添加background-image属性来指定图片路径。
4. 根据需要,可以使用CSS的其他属性调整图片的样式和布局。
以上就是在PHP中添加图片的方法和操作流程。根据实际需求选择合适的方法,可以实现网站或应用中的图片展示效果。